Social Director Duties & An Detailed Summary

The primary function of a community manager involves cultivating a engaged community around a product. Their daily duties cover everything from observing digital platforms for references to personally interacting with users. This often involves developing compelling content, answering customer inquiries promptly, and overseeing online discussions. A skilled social director also reviews statistics to assess the effectiveness of their initiatives and identifies areas for optimization. Ultimately, they are brand advocates responsible with maintaining a good reputation and increasing customer loyalty.

Creating a Thriving Online Community: Strategies for Success

Building a successful online community demands more than just setting up a site; it requires a careful approach and consistent work. To foster a truly vibrant space, begin by defining your focus and clearly articulating your purpose. Regularly offer valuable content – updates – that resonates with your members and sparks conversation. Actively supervise the discussions, encouraging respectful communication and addressing any concerns promptly. Consider implementing rewards to acknowledge active members and cultivate a sense of belonging. Finally, consistently advertise your community across various networks to attract new users and expand your reach.
